Bring on the casinos
published: Monday | March 17, 2003

THE EDITOR, Sir:

AFTER READING the churches' opposition to casino gambling in Jamaica, I was forced to submit this letter.

It is highly hypocritical of the Catholic church to condemn gambling, when they benefit tremendously from their "bingo nights." If the government can allow lotteries, and horse racing in Jamaica, then controlled casino gambling can do nothing but benefit the economy.

I suggest if you want the churches' blessing, promise them a percentage of the take, then you will see how quickly they agree.

Although casino gambling will bring millions of dollars of foreign exchange in the country, we need to clean up Montego Bay, they will come but they may not return if they are not comfortable with the surroundings.

Enough of this "henny penny" the sky is falling nonsense! Bring on the casinos.
